What is LEARNU • Lab of Edutainment Architectures for Revolutionary New Uses • LEARNU is a lab of the University of Hawaii, Department of Information and Computer Sciences that explores the advancement of computer and information sciences and education in modern game console platforms. • Focus on ‘Edu-tainment’: Education & Entertainment • Developer kits donated from SquareSoft- allowing us to develop PlayStation Applications • Project of Instructor David Nickles

  4. How the Project Started • SquareSoft going out of business…www.squareusa.com • Donation of PSX development kits • PlayStation is a widely-used and widely-available platform, which is easy to use by people of all ages, and is great for multimedia applications

  6. Game Design • Techniques were studied, from the book “Game Design, Theory and Practice” by Richard Rouse III • Game Design principles were studied, and applied to our projects

  7. Some ‘Good’ Game Design Principles • Challenging • Bragging Rights • Good Graphics and Sounds • Room for Fantasy / Immersion • Consistency • Accomplishable Tasks • Humor • Artificial Intelligence

  8. A Challenging Game • Steady increase in difficulty • First level easy, later levels hard • Makes the game appealing to gamers of different skill levels- beginners and experts

  9. Bragging Rights • I got the highest score! • Pac-Man style of getting to the highest level possible and obtaining the highest score • A good game will have people bragging to their friends about the score they achieved

  10. Good Graphics / Sounds • Many good games in the past, but they had much less powerful hardware • Resulted in simpler games than today • Still fun to play, but can’t compare with the latest games out today • Good sounds and graphics add realism to the game

  11. Fantasy / Immersion • Good games absorb the person playing the game • Gamers can fantasize that they are in the world that the game presents • Gamer is unaware of the hours flying by

  12. Consistency • Gamers expect a consistent interface and game play • Not following this convention will frustrate the game player • Switching the game ‘rules’ mid-stream will leave gamers complaining about the game programmers

  13. Accomplishable Tasks • Tasks in the game should be something that is realistic for the gamer to accomplish • Gamer shouldn’t get hopelessly stuck • Gamers expect to fail, otherwise it wouldn’t be challenging

  14. Humor • Fun games can be funny • I tried to do this with adding a South Park theme to my game • Characters are funny- big head / little bodies, similar to South Park theme • You might recognize some of the characters...

  15. And Finally... AI • Artificial Intelligence- needs to match the complexity of the game • Often referred to as ‘Artificial Stupidity’ • Can be simple, as long as the game play doesn’t get too predictable

My Final Project • I worked on several projects over the year, and I will present my final project for this semester • Is a shooter-style game- objective is to kill your opponent before he kills you • There is a catch in the game- the orange figure in the snow-suit (Kenny) is your friend, and you cannot shoot him

  17. My Final Project • Game allows you to duck behind a wall • Several different levels, with different enemies and settings • Several difficulty levels • Upon passing a difficulty level, you continue by restarting on a higher difficulty level

  18. My Final Project • Gun shot effects- such as seeing gun flashes, having different gun sounds for shooting or being shot at, and having a red flash on the screen when you are hit • Characters in the game follow a random AI, through a state machine • Game is played using the PlayStation light gun
